Na Nikitina residential quarter, Novosibirsk, Russia
In the early 20th century a market square and wooden cottages were sited in the area. The two-storey houses built just after WWII had fallen into ruin by the early 21 century and their residents were relocated. In 2016 Brusnika development company proceeded to design and construct a new housing estate on the site. The master plan, the architecture concept and the fronts of houses were designed by the Netherlands based DROM bureau. The core of the master plan is to restore the historic grid of streets and the outline of quarters, while preserving human-scaled proportions and open structure built-up areas.
